Fig. 2
Synthesis and characterization of AtDTC. (
a
) Detection of synthesized
AtDTC proteins by CBB staining. The proteins were synthesized by liposome-
supplemented WGCF system. After protein synthesis, the reaction mixture was
centrifuged at 20,000 ×
g
for 20 min at 4 °C. The total (T), supernatant (S), and
pellet (P) fractions were subjected to SDS-PAGE and analyzed by CBB staining.
(
b
) Time course of the incorporation of external substrate [
14
C]2-oxoglutarate into
proteoliposomes reconstituted with AtDTC. AtDTC was synthesized by liposome-
supplemented WGCF system. The liposomes and synthesized protein complexes
were sedimented by centrifugation, and reconstituted into proteoliposomes
preloaded with 30 mM of 2-oxoglutarate. Intake of [
14
C]2-oxoglutarate was
measured (reproduced from ref.
2
)

6. Mix 150
μ
l of the sonicated resuspended pellet with 150
μ
l of
substrate-preloaded liposomes.
7. Sonicate the mixed liposomes at room temperature for 18 s
(10 % amplitude and 50 % duty cycle). This is the proteolipo-
some solution.
8. Freeze the proteoliposome solution with liquid nitrogen
(
see
Note 7
).
9. Thaw the proteoliposome solution at room temperature.
